diff options
author | Justin Bronder <jsbronder@gentoo.org> | 2011-02-01 11:07:08 -0500 |
---|---|---|
committer | Justin Bronder <jsbronder@gentoo.org> | 2011-02-01 11:07:19 -0500 |
commit | 822bb4effede8811ac2617913ae0432b8cb71d05 (patch) | |
tree | 27c2deb1452025e0f7b3109838dd2b886642982a /sys-cluster/openmpi | |
parent | solve file collision in paraview (diff) | |
download | sci-822bb4effede8811ac2617913ae0432b8cb71d05.tar.gz sci-822bb4effede8811ac2617913ae0432b8cb71d05.tar.bz2 sci-822bb4effede8811ac2617913ae0432b8cb71d05.zip |
Bump, #349076. Re-enable tests with mpi-threads. Add prefix stuff.
Diffstat (limited to 'sys-cluster/openmpi')
-rw-r--r-- | sys-cluster/openmpi/ChangeLog | 8 | ||||
-rw-r--r-- | sys-cluster/openmpi/Manifest | 18 | ||||
-rw-r--r-- | sys-cluster/openmpi/metadata.xml | 3 | ||||
-rw-r--r-- | sys-cluster/openmpi/openmpi-1.5.1.ebuild (renamed from sys-cluster/openmpi/openmpi-1.4.2-r1.ebuild) | 13 |
4 files changed, 19 insertions, 23 deletions
diff --git a/sys-cluster/openmpi/ChangeLog b/sys-cluster/openmpi/ChangeLog index ddb9746e8..7d40e55b5 100644 --- a/sys-cluster/openmpi/ChangeLog +++ b/sys-cluster/openmpi/ChangeLog @@ -1,7 +1,13 @@ # ChangeLog for sys-cluster/openmpi -#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 +#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2 # $Header: $ +*openmpi-1.5.1 (01 Feb 2011) + + 01 Feb 2011; Justin Bronder <jsbronder@gentoo.org> -openmpi-1.4.2-r1.ebuild, + +openmpi-1.5.1.ebuild: + Bump, #349076. Re-enable tests with mpi-threads. Add prefix stuff. + 16 Dec 2010; Justin Lecher <jlec@gentoo.org> openmpi-1.4.2-r1.ebuild: Removal of fortran.eclass, #348851 diff --git a/sys-cluster/openmpi/Manifest b/sys-cluster/openmpi/Manifest index 4c88a3262..aede05899 100644 --- a/sys-cluster/openmpi/Manifest +++ b/sys-cluster/openmpi/Manifest @@ -1,16 +1,6 @@ ------BEGIN PGP SIGNED MESSAGE----- -Hash: SHA1 - AUX eselect.mpi.openmpi 225 RMD160 cf81165864aaad2833f7a8300c20376210a575dd SHA1 8b50b90346b52b831a59ec0abd8e3dbebad2b94e SHA256 df4d363e9fbab74c234b75f426b7f38ef83d16da2b099222c0dde4a2c3ece687 AUX openmpi-1.4.1-r22513.patch 2460 RMD160 94c6ca7c7d869039e73f1dbd5402ccd0d5949f11 SHA1 a924c63a94546f25a25beb15328ff2ee18c388e8 SHA256 083528f3ccdda8e1654accd5a6d3c79231d7d727cbd1f05293d7850a32503379 -DIST openmpi-1.4.2.tar.bz2 6630550 RMD160 2c9fbcc8f77e7fa28e2bd062875d484548cc0b79 SHA1 3e85092433d0e399cc7a51c018f9d13562f78b80 SHA256 19129e3d51860ad0a7497ede11563908ba99c76b3a51a4d0b8801f7e2db6cd80 -EBUILD openmpi-1.4.2-r1.ebuild 2860 RMD160 25d56a7109f0320d1609c96309aef0f86fbf882a SHA1 5080559033ad1b6097afea75cd5d8fb0123aff12 SHA256 6545de817901c18e072c669072ce0a6f884344b9eb83434ba3e7fdd617ab60a9 -MISC ChangeLog 3009 RMD160 da7b8c02162b48b74157cfe4f762ac12d9d33a17 SHA1 2e9106423c9b26fe24483610730328dd8edda557 SHA256 27790c4cc8a49dbbc357f41adbff59806d6ac8c6a9a9a901ea739b872cdbb8ba -MISC metadata.xml 706 RMD160 d497cb759e382f2b07d5233f99f391e5c6f667d3 SHA1 870215f9b18002f5dc24fa742b0e740a8d730e4f SHA256 11a597b8ce26a8293a4b7ad9f0373c0c57ad99425ede80e8136747fab504807e ------B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.16 (GNU/Linux) - -iEYEARECAAYFAk0OWkoACgkQgAnW8HDreRaRBwCgx/E1zt3U6dOOcM6ssvt3DDpG -NYUAoLHPZ8jRydAdkOpJKLx3cvww8N/4 -=ljME ------END PGP SIGNATURE----- +DIST openmpi-1.5.1.tar.bz2 7410701 RMD160 25b5b6e68c28eb406bee148d65908f876e7bd35b SHA1 fe21acc211fe60e30dc6bef1c83a70c34e093998 SHA256 c28bb0bd367ceeec08f739d815988fca54fc4818762e6abcaa6cfedd6fd52274 +EBUILD openmpi-1.5.1.ebuild 2902 RMD160 7c35394bee13c14f160a3cac2af20d331c639acc SHA1 ad807136dcdd65f70fc181cf629040cf942fd567 SHA256 b463d19bfd97394d0fbb258633215f0ec19301072c3a65cfc891b1c970ce7e5e +MISC ChangeLog 3215 RMD160 41b0a58469a3572dc607289f6809fef15623fef3 SHA1 0d0fbf4d782cbb39d3514e97983bfa22cdf3049c SHA256 5b9cd99b38d9f4814bee77a645100cfeebd07ff52952579d953f2c6be5202ca1 +MISC metadata.xml 656 RMD160 223aeb0c645345a35fc674e30cc9f17d936db762 SHA1 f0af00a84589ada70477d0fa12afe21c57a16071 SHA256 809b9f410e784da55e240612ca9542e718f25f65819acda4b3429b22114619e6 diff --git a/sys-cluster/openmpi/metadata.xml b/sys-cluster/openmpi/metadata.xml index 3b7de719d..f583154b3 100644 --- a/sys-cluster/openmpi/metadata.xml +++ b/sys-cluster/openmpi/metadata.xml @@ -1,7 +1,7 @@ <?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> <pkgmetadata> - <herd>hp-cluster</herd> + <herd>cluster</herd> <maintainer> <email>jsbronder@gentoo.org</email> </maintainer> @@ -13,6 +13,5 @@ <flag name='mpi-threads'>Enable MPI_THREAD_MULTIPLE</flag> <flag name='vt'>Enable bundled VampirTrace support</flag> <flag name='infiniband'>Enable infiniband support</flag> - <flag name='dapl'>Enable dapl support</flag> </use> </pkgmetadata> diff --git a/sys-cluster/openmpi/openmpi-1.4.2-r1.ebuild b/sys-cluster/openmpi/openmpi-1.5.1.ebuild index 8c316cb0a..25bea8d17 100644 --- a/sys-cluster/openmpi/openmpi-1.4.2-r1.ebuild +++ b/sys-cluster/openmpi/openmpi-1.5.1.ebuild @@ -1,4 +1,4 @@ -# Copyright 1999-2010 Gentoo Foundation +# Copyright 1999-2011 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 # $Header: /var/cvsroot/gentoo-x86/sys-cluster/openmpi/openmpi-1.2.4.ebuild,v 1.2 2007/12/13 22:39:53 jsbronder Exp $ @@ -10,18 +10,19 @@ S=${WORKDIR}/${MY_P} DESCRIPTION="A high-performance message passing library (MPI)" HOMEPAGE="http://www.open-mpi.org" -SRC_URI="http://www.open-mpi.org/software/ompi/v1.4/downloads/${MY_P}.tar.bz2" +SRC_URI="http://www.open-mpi.org/software/ompi/v1.5/downloads/${MY_P}.tar.bz2" LICENSE="BSD" SLOT="0" KEYWORDS="~alpha ~amd64 ~ppc ~ppc64 ~sparc ~x86" -RESTRICT="mpi-threads? ( test )" -IUSE="+cxx fortran heterogeneous ipv6 infiniband mpi-threads pbs romio threads vt" +#RESTRICT="mpi-threads? ( test )" +IUSE="+cxx elibc_FreeBSD fortran heterogeneous ipv6 infiniband mpi-threads pbs romio threads vt" RDEPEND="pbs? ( sys-cluster/torque ) vt? ( !dev-libs/libotf !app-text/lcdf-typetools ) infiniband? ( sys-infiniband/libibverbs ) + elibc_FreeBSD? ( dev-libs/libexecinfo ) $(mpi_imp_deplist)" DEPEND="${RDEPEND}" @@ -59,10 +60,10 @@ src_prepare() { src_configure() { local myconf=( --sysconfdir="${EPREFIX}/etc/${PN}" - --without-xgrid --enable-pretty-print-stacktrace --enable-orterun-prefix-by-default - --without-slurm) + --without-slurm + ) if use mpi-threads; then myconf+=(--enable-mpi-threads |